More Wii U details will come in the Fall, not before

Recommended Videos

Ever since the Wii U was officially unveiled, fans have been clamoring for a price point and a release date above all other details. Well, it looks like you’re going to have to wait a little bit longer, as all of that info is allegedly going to be released this Fall.

Gematsu is reporting that a reliable investor broke the ice, and stated that Nintendo will announce everything after a stockholder’s meeting later this year — game updates are also set to be included in this announcement.

I’m really hoping that Nintendo Land is bundled with the console, as I plan on getting at least four games at launch — I don’t hate my wallet that much.
